Toolbox

  • User friendly Graphical User Interface, Matlab based
  • Global analysis of time dependent data
  • Demos and manual supplied with the program
  • Singular Value Decomposition (SVD) and fitting of Left Singular Vectors using any model
  • Instrument Response Function (IRF) and chirp
  • Standard library of reaction models supplied
  • Graphically design any connectivity ('target') model
  • Store and re-use fitting session parameters

 

 





TooboxPhotoselection theory applied to multiple pulses in the presence of decay

  • Photoselection theory for finite bleach applied to pump-probe and multi-pulse (pump-dump-probe and pump-repump-probe) spectroscopy
  • Explicit population, laser field orientation and decay dependence
  • Angle resolved and ensemble averaged photolysed fraction calculation
  • Beam diameters included for pump1, pump2 and probe
  • Choice of Gaussian and multi-mode beams
  • Fractional photolysis calculation required for correcting pump-dump-probe signal amplitudes
  • Provides power density dependent corrections to measured anisotropy in photoselection studies
